On Mar 20, 2011, at 23:52, Krissy Masters wrote: > I am loading content into a div so left menu click loads the element into the > right side…pretty simple. But how do you prevent the page from always jumping > to the top? Layout has header, intro, page title then the content starts but > everytime I click a side nav ajax link it loads the content fine but always > jumps the page back to the top.
This would be normal behavior, if you have something like: <a href="#" onclick="somethingAjax()">click</a> That is, href="#" means "scroll to the top". If you don't want to scroll to the top when clicked, don't set href to "#".
